CAROL PAYNE

Painter and Teacher
of Decorative Art
Carol Payne has been painting since 1972 and taught her first classes in 1975.
Over the years Carol has taken seminars with Ginger Edwards, Joan Johnson, Helen Barrick,
Pat Clark, Joyce Howard, Karl-Heinz Meschbach and many other well known artist and
teachers. These experiences have led Carol to her particular style which is best described
as refined, detailed folk art which she paints on almost any surface in acrylics.
Carol is a member of the Society of Decorative Painters and an active member of
the local chapter, Penns Woods Painters. Working from her home studio in
Mechanicsburg, Carol currently has weekly classes offered to beginners, intermediate and
advanced students.
As a graduate of the University of Missouri, Carol was trained in education and
brings these tools to the classroom and seminars. She has traveled to teach seminars in a
number of US cities which she thoroughly enjoys.
Carols credentials include teaching at the SDP National Convention,
selection for SDP Decorative Arts Collection judging, recipient of PBS Judges Choice
award, various art show honors, prizes, ribbons and, of course, her university training.
Her work has also been selected to be featured in the Decorative
Painter Magazine. While recognized many times as a fine painter, Carols teaching
skills are exceptional. Not only will she provide assistance in specific techniques
designed to advance the skills of the student, Carol will also display her creative
approach to the selection of unique and interesting pieces. She is also a DecoArt Helping
Artist.
